Maternal serum markers in second-trimester oligohydramnios

F J Los1, A M Hagenaars, T E Cohen-Overbeek

  • 1Department of Clinical Genetics, University Hospital Dijkzigt, Erasmus University, Rotterdam, The Netherlands.

Prenatal Diagnosis
|July 1, 1994
PubMed
Summary

Maternal serum screening for early second-trimester oligohydramnios shows altered levels of alpha-fetoprotein (AFP), human chorionic gonadotrophin (hCG), and unconjugated oestriol (uE3), increasing false positives for fetal abnormalities.

Area of Science:

  • Maternal-fetal medicine
  • Biochemistry
  • Prenatal diagnostics

Background:

  • Oligohydramnios, a condition of low amniotic fluid, can impact fetal development and pregnancy outcomes.
  • Maternal serum screening (MSS) using alpha-fetoprotein (AFP), human chorionic gonadotrophin (hCG), and unconjugated oestriol (uE3) is standard for detecting fetal anomalies.
  • The specific impact of early second-trimester oligohydramnios on MSS marker profiles requires further investigation.

Purpose of the Study:

  • To investigate the maternal serum marker profiles (AFP, hCG, uE3) in early second-trimester oligohydramnios.
  • To compare these profiles with a reference population of uncomplicated singleton pregnancies.
  • To assess the effect of oligohydramnios on the screen-positive rates for fetal Down's syndrome and neural tube defects.

Main Methods:

  • Retrospective analysis of maternal serum samples from 35 pregnancies with early second-trimester oligohydramnios.
  • Comparison with a reference group of 1699 singleton pregnancies without oligohydramnios.
  • Analysis of AFP, hCG, and uE3 levels, comparing them against population-specific centiles.

Main Results:

  • Significantly different maternal serum marker levels were observed in oligohydramnios cases compared to the reference population.
  • Elevated AFP (above 95th centile) was found in 80% of oligohydramnios cases with normal fetuses, versus 20% with malformed fetuses.
  • Elevated hCG (26%) and decreased uE3 (17%) were noted irrespective of fetal condition, leading to a 57% screen-positive rate for fetal abnormalities.

Conclusions:

  • Early second-trimester oligohydramnios is associated with distinct maternal serum marker profiles.
  • These altered profiles significantly increase the screen-positive rate for fetal Down's syndrome and neural tube defects.
  • Further research is needed to refine screening protocols for pregnancies complicated by oligohydramnios.
